As a Senior Pharmacy Benefit Consultant, you will serve as the primary/lead consultant on strategic clients. You will lead and cultivate multi-level client relationships with executives, human resource personnel, pharmacy department personnel and others which enable PSG to partner with clients to create, communicate and implement pharmacy strategy within the context of the overall client drug management strategy. In addition, you will identify business needs and create custom solutions for sophisticated clients which include overall pharmacy benefit strategy to create cost effective solutions for various client types. You will also lead vendor strategies that will include procurement efforts, contract negotiation and ongoing vendor management, while providing industry expertise and insight related to trends and opportunities.

Pharmaceutical Strategies Group (PSG), an EPIC company, is a leading pharmacy intelligence and technology firm that provides innovative drug cost management solutions. For over 25 years, PSG has been a steadfast advocate for its clients, helping them navigate the intricate and constantly evolving landscape of pharmaceutical expenses. The company's core mission is to partner with clients to develop pioneering drug management strategies that yield exceptional financial and clinical value. PSG serves a diverse clientele, including self-insured employers, health plans, brokers, coalitions, and health systems, functioning as a strategic partner to achieve significant savings and optimize health outcomes. Annually, PSG is responsible for generating billions of dollars in drug cost savings for its clients.

At the heart of PSG's offerings is its proprietary data and analytics platform, Artemetrx®. This advanced technology integrates pharmacy and medical claims data to provide actionable insights and a holistic view of specialty drug spending and trends. Artemetrx empowers clients with the intelligence needed to manage high-cost specialty drugs effectively, identify cost-saving opportunities, and improve patient care. The platform's capabilities include sophisticated algorithms for risk identification, financial modeling for gene therapies, and custom reporting. PSG's team of experienced consultants, including clinical pharmacists and financial analysts, leverages this technology to deliver tailored solutions. These solutions range from pharmacy benefit management (PBM) procurement and contracting to audits, clinical optimization, and market research. The company's commitment to transparency, integrity, and innovation has established it as a trusted, independent voice in the pharmacy benefits industry, consistently delivering measurable results and fostering long-term partnerships with its clients.
